Verðandi is the Norse goddess of present fate. She lives among this clan of dragons. She is the middle of the three Norns, Norse goddesses of destiny. The Norns are in charge of the World Tree, Yggdrasil. Every day, they take water from the Well of Fate, mix it with clay, and pour it over the tree’s branches to stop it from decaying.
Verðandi, as the middle of the Norns, rules over the present. Her name means “that which is”. Verðandi winds the thread of life after it is spun by her older sister Urð; the youngest sister, Skuld, then cuts the thread at the appointed time, ending the life.
